Yes, I really booked with Cleartrip - I was completely desperate by that stage, having tried every way I could think of to book direct with Deccan!
It accepted a foreign card without any problem. I gave the address of an Indian hotel, but the ticket was an eticket, so the address was never used at all. I got a an email confirmation pretty promptly, which I printed out and took with me. The flight was fine with no problems, it was about 6 weeks ago. And the flight was even on time ;-) ....although Cleartrip cannot have had any influence there! Good luck with your booking. |
